基於上一篇隨筆后,新需求需要再導出的表格上面加一行標題行 ...
最近在做項目,需要從頁面的表格中導出excel,一般導出excel有兩種方法:一 習慣上是建模版從后台服務程序中導出 二 根據頁面table中導出 綜合考慮其中利弊選擇二 根據頁面table中導出excel,前段有用table的也有用vue的,結佣file saver和xlsx插件進行導出excel。 沒有做封裝,直接改的源碼 頁面中需要引入文件 此處的xlsx.full.js是由https: g ...
2018-05-08 10:36 2 3635 推薦指數:
基於上一篇隨筆后,新需求需要再導出的表格上面加一行標題行 ...
最近在做項目,前端進行處理數據,導出excel中,還是遇到不少問題,這里將其進行總結一下,博主是vue框架開發,借用file-saver和xlsx插件進行導出excel,我們來看下代碼和效果。地址鏈接如下:https://www.npmjs.com/package/js-xlsx 博主 ...
一、引入插件 1、npm命令引入插件依賴: 2、頁面引入 二、使用插件導出數據 1、給El-Table加id: 2、觸發導出事件: (1)參數method為需要導出的表格id; (2)經過去除fixed元素操作 ...
1、安裝:npm install file-saver xlsx --save-dev 2、引入:import FileSaver from 'file-save'; import XLSX from 'xlsx'; 3、點擊事件: exportExcel ...
前記:最近真的挺忙的,一件事接着一件,都忘了我的React項目,盡管這是一個沒寫概率沒寫離散的夜晚,我決定還是先做做我的React 好了,進入正題 項目需求,需要導入和導出表單,發現前端已經強大到無所不能(可惜我有點懶,學的並不勤快) 因此使用到js-xlsx,附上github地址:https ...
剛剛找到了一個前端導出列表比較不錯的插件js-xlsx ,能夠繼續單元格合並,速度也有了很大提升之后,領導又說,能設置樣式嗎?例如標題字體、居中等等。我查找了相關的資料,js-xlsx這個插件是支持樣式設置的,我安裝網上的方法一一嘗試了下,都沒有作用。最后,通過請教了一位大神,得到了想要 ...
<template> <div class="index"> <input type="file" @change="importFile(this)" id="imFile" style="display: none ...
之前寫文章介紹了使用 js-xlsx 實現導入 excel 的功能,現在再介紹一下如何使用 js-xlsx 進行 excel 導出。 【實現步驟】 1. 首先安裝依賴 2. 在組件中導入 xlsx 3. 提供導出按鈕,編寫導出方法 ...